Characteristics of the ANDI members and patients Over the past several years, an opinion has emerged in India that the current practical curricula in medical schools fail to meet many of the objectives for which they were instituted. Hence, this study has assessed the perception of physiology faculty members regarding the current experimental physiology curriculum in one Indian state, Gujarat. The faculty were of the opinion that many of the topics currently taught in experimental physiology (amphibian nerve-muscle and heart muscle experiments) were outdated and clinically irrelevant: Therefore, the faculty advocated that duration of teaching time devoted to some of these topics should be reduced and topics with clinical relevance should be introduced at the undergraduate level. The faculty also felt that more emphasis should be laid on highlighting the clinical aspect related to each concept taught in experimental physiology Moreover, a majority of faculty members were in favour of replacing the current practice in Gujarat of teaching experimental physiology only by explanation of graphs obtained from experiments conducted in the previous years, with computer assisted learning in small groups. PMID:26571992 The research retrospectively reviewed closed claims data from two insurance companies concerned with malpractice settlements. It covered the majority of Massachusetts doctors over a five year period, between January 2005 and December 2009. Every malpractice claim insured by the two largest insurers was screened, and 551 claims from primary care practices were identified for analysis (out of a total of 7,224 malpractice claims). Medical Malpractice, Battery, & The MIlitary A doctor (Dr. A) witness for the defendant testified that wrist restraints are routinely used for intensive unit patients who are often at increased risk of injuring themselves by pulling out therapies such as IV lines, endotracheal tubes, central lines and chest tubes. He also stated that wrist restraints allow for some range of motion and enable a degree of flexion and extension of the wrists and elbows and pronation and supination of the arms, as evidenced by the fact that on January 30, 2005 plaintiff was seen holding the dislodged chest tube tubing with his restrained left hand. The doctor said that there was no evidence that plaintiff's wrist restraints ever caused circulatory impairment, were improperly positioned, or that plaintiff developed any pressure sores in the wrist area; and that the wrists restraints were a necessary and vital part of plaintiff's management. The physician and her staff have a duty to document the informed consent, and this is typically done on a pre-printed procedure form. The risks should be appropriately documented and the form should be signed by the patient and witnessed. Be aware of additions made to the form after the procedure was performed. Often the consent form is a multi-part form which creates duplicate originals; these should be compared with each other if there are doubts about the authenticity of the hospital record. Failure to Diagnose or Misdiagnosis: Failing to diagnose or diagnosing a patient with the wrong illness is all too common as many illnesses have common symptoms. Malpractices arises because the delay in treatment often results in injury to the patients as their undiagnosed illness progressively worsens. In addition, providing medications to treat a patient for an illness they do not have usually causes unintended consequences by creating an imbalance in the body and putting the patient at even more risk. In these cases liability may result if another reasonably prudent doctor would have considered the illness with the same or substantially similar circumstances present. The proposed expert must be a member of the same profession, a medical doctor testifying as to the standard of care of a defendant who is a doctor of osteopathy, or be a doctor of osteopathy testifying as to the standard of care of a defendant who is a medical doctor. Notwithstanding that general rule, an expert who is a physician and, as a result of having, during at least three of the last five years immediately preceding the time the act or omission is alleged to have occurred, supervised, taught, or instructed nurses, nurse practitioners, certified registered nurse anesthetists, nurse midwives, physician assistants, physical therapists, occupational therapists, or medical support staff, has knowledge of the standard of care of that health care provider under the circumstances at issue shall be competent to testify as to the standard of that health care provider.

To the extent that the law firm could have claimed in its defense that it could not have known of the relationship between the MABSTOA, MTA, NYCTA and the relevant bus operators identified in the crew report, the court in Delacruz v. Metropolitan Transportation Authority, 45 AD3d 482 1 Dept. 2007, held that the injured plaintiff could not claim that, by the actions of the MTA, he was lulled into a false sense of security that his lawyer sued the right public authority. The court specifically held the doctrine of equitable estoppel applies only when a governmental subdivision acts wrongfully or negligently inducing reliance by a party who is entitled to rely and who changes his position to his detriment or prejudice. There was no evidence here of any wrongful conduct by the NYCTA; it did not hide the information about MABSTOA or mislead the injured driver's lawyer. The pre-anesthesia records typically record the operative plans and contain check lists for pre-operative data and patient assessment. Most importantly, the records contain the identity of all of the participants in the procedure, including the circulating and scrub nurses, the anesthesiologists and anesthetists, and the surgeons and their assistants. Final assessment of the patient for tolerance of the procedure should take place at this point. Spinal Cord Injuries (SCI) - This occurs when an injury to this area of the body disrupts the movement of information from the brain to other nerves in the body that lead to muscles, skin and internal organs. When the flow of information is interrupted this can cause paralysis or other forms of permanent damage. SCI recovery process often requires ongoing therapy, surgeries and medication to help the patient handle daily functions. According to the VA, about 42,000 veterans suffer from a serious SCI that will require ongoing treatment. Paralysis is a condition that occurs from a SCI injury. There are many causes that lead to both traumatic and non-traumatic paralysis. Traumatic events can be auto accidents, falls military work or sport event. Non-traumatic events such as cancer, arthritis, infection and disk degeneration can also cause paralysis. Veterans can become a victim to either form. Orthodontics Dental Negligence Solicitors Increasingly these days, it is not sufficient just to take good care of one's patients. Dentists need to be constantly on their guard in relation to the regulations prohibiting dentists from canvassing for patients by deliberate solicitation for business, especially in view of the all too easy dissemination of material via the internet. Two dentists have come unstuck in recent years; one for thinking (or at least arguing at the Inquiry) that an article which urged the children of elderly parents to show filial piety by paying for computer-guided dental implant surgery for their parents constituted an article for the purposes of dental health education, and the other for failing to stop his hospital's marketing department from seeking to publish a promotional article by him in a well-known newspaper, despite evidence that he was not aware of the department's intentions. Risk management involves the development of a plan to monitor areas of a dental practice, including, but not limited to, the doctor-patient relationship (DPR), informed consent, and documentation, otherwise referred to as a triad of concerns to avoid perceived or potential problems in the practice of dentistry.1,2 Understanding the issues, communicating appropriately when entering into a doctor-patient relationship, following the concepts of informed consent and documentation and then properly applying them are the ways to prevent dental malpractice litigation. Those three areas are more likely than not to be abused or neglected but are generally governed by the standard of care of the profession and can be the source of allegations. The FDA said that its authority over dietary supplements is very different from its authority over drugs and other medical products. FDA is required to undertake what are usually lengthy scientific and legal steps in order to force the removal of dietary supplements that may be unsafe or are otherwise illegal if companies don't voluntarily comply. Negligence Defined. Someone is negligent if he was not reasonably careful under the circumstances. It is not enough for the attorney to prove simply that defendant could have avoided the accident by doing something differently. No mechanic, pilot, or other defendant is expected to be perfect. He is, however, expected to be as careful as others would have been in the same situation. If he was not, then he was negligent. In conjunction with Schneider's arrest, the MFCU and the Jacksonville Sheriff's Office have an active arrest warrant for one of Schneider's former dental assistants, LaTosha Bevel-Hillsman, for practicing dentistry without a license, defrauding the Florida Medicaid program and child abuse. Hillsman, 39, allegedly performed an extraction on a pediatric patient; a procedure that Hillsman is not authorized to perform. The investigation revealed that this procedure caused harm to the child and produced unauthorized claims submitted to the Medicaid program for reimbursement.
